East Asia, China, Neolithic Period, ca. 3000 to 2000 BCE. A nicely-proportioned redware cup with a rounded lower body, a flat base, and a large, flared spout. Three strap handles descend from the unpronounced rim to midway on the body. Utilitarian vessels like this one reflect the skill of Chinese artisans even at this early date. Size: 4.85" W x 3.25" H (12.3 cm x 8.3 cm)
